When in first inversion, you may choose to double the third of the ii ... WebHowever, when the chord is in first inversion, any doubling is possible. The best choice of doubling depends on where the chord is leading. If IV6 progresses to a root-position V, then doubling the fifth of IV6 is probably best. On the other hand, if IV6 progresses to V6, then doubling the third of IV6 may be better. can shrimp tails be composted

WebBy far, the two most common ways to voice a 1st inversion triad is having a complete triad in the top (meaning the root is doubled) or having R-5-R in the upper parts - an 8ve with the 5th in the middle. After that, 5-R-5 is common. The last group is those where the doubled note is in unison - R-R-5 or 5-R-R, or 5-5-R or R-5-5 in the top.
